This challenging hiking route will take you to the Col du Laurenti and Pont de Claude area, offering stunning views and various points of interest along the way. The trail covers a distance of 8.509 kilometers with an elevation gain of 598 meters, making it a difficult but rewarding hike.
Starting from the parking lot near Étang de Laurenti, you will pass by the Refuge Forestier du Laurenti, which serves as a wilderness hut and a potential camping spot for hikers. Further along the trail, you will encounter the Maquis du Roc Blanc memorial, providing a glimpse into the area's historic past.
As you continue on the route, you will come across the Cabane du Counc, another wilderness hut that offers a resting place and a chance to enjoy the surrounding natural beauty. Be sure to check out the Étang de Laurenti and take in the peaceful atmosphere of this scenic spot.
